The Sapper, mentioned in the Sentry Gun Operational Guide as the FM/AM Sapper, is the default secondary weapon of the Spy. It is a small box inscribed 'Electro-Sapper' and sports a dial and switches. It also features two clamps that are deployed when used.

The sole function of the Sapper is to destroy an Engineer's buildings. Should the player select the weapon and stand near an enemy structure, they will be able to see a white outline of the Sapper on the building, indicating that it is in range and can be sapped. Additionally, the needle on the gauge will move to the right red zone. Pressing the primary fire key, default MOUSE1, will attach the weapon, and the building will slowly be damaged until it is destroyed. A sapped building will cease to function; Sentry Guns will not fire, Dispensers will not heal or dispense ammo and Teleporters will not teleport. When applied to buildings, the Sapper will produce electrical sparks and a loud hissing noise. When a Sapper is attached to one end of a Teleporter, another Sapper is automatically placed on the other end of the Teleporter, if it exists. If the Spy is disguised, the disguise class will play a distinct, unique animation of placing the device on the building.

For each building the Spy player places a Sapper upon, a small window in their HUD will appear showing both the remaining health of the building sapped and the health of the Sapper on that building.

Once the building is being sapped, the Engineer owner will be alerted to it in his HUD, and will automatically play a voice clip alerting nearby players of the building's predicament. Engineers can remove a Sapper with two hits from their melee weapon. When a Sapper is attacked, the Spy player will be notified by a similar alert in their HUD. If an Engineer removes a Sapper from a Teleporter, the Sapper at the other end is also removed. If another Engineer strikes the Sapper first, he can get an assist for the Sapper kill, and a Medic healing an Engineer can also score an assist in this way. Pyros equipped with the Homewrecker can also destroy Sappers in one hit if they happen upon them. Enemies focused on removing Sappers may leave themselves open to a backstab or headshot, allowing the Spy or a teammate to distract and dispose of enemies in addition to the building in question.

The Sapper has infinite ammunition and no discernible "cooldown" time; Sappers can be placed on a building faster than an Engineer can repair the damage each one causes, which guarantees the building will be destroyed if the Spy is not dealt with. This tactic seldom works if there are multiple players around.

The Sapper breaks into metal fragments upon removal. The fragments can only be picked up for metal after being destroyed on a Dispenser, each gib giving 3 metal.

Damage and function times

See also: Damage
Damage and function times
Damage
Base damage 100% 25 / s
Function times
Building destroy time
Level 1:
6.00 s
Level 2:
7.20 s
Level 3:
8.64 s
Mini-Sentry:
4.00 s
Values are approximate and determined by community testing.

Bugs

  • A Spy with multiple Sappers active at once will only see the HUD display of the oldest one.
  • The Sapper clamps do not attach to the sides of the Sentry Gun.
  • An issue can occur when the Sapper is placed on a building that upgrades to the next level at the same time; the Sapper will be unremovable by both Engineers or Pyros equipped with the Homewrecker or Maul. Additionally, the sapped building will function as normal, albeit with draining health. Hauling the affected building corrects the problem.
  • Occasionally, the Sapper will play an alternate drawn animation in which the Spy flips a switch on the Sapper's interface. The animation is rushed and does not play correctly, however, the sound of the switch being flicked can still be heard.
  • Switching to the Sapper with the flipped viewmodels option turned on, the words "Electro-Sapper" are displayed mirrored.
  • The idle animation does not play during a replay, causing the needle to remain still.

Trivia

  • Sappers are considered by the game to be buildings. As such, they are immune to critical hits (they are not destroyed in one hit by a single critical Wrench swing) and can be created with the build console command.
